Title: Hans device expiration
Post by: olepaw on January 15, 2012, 04:01:26 PM
Do hans devices have expiration date , like helmets do ? hate to spend big bucks on something that may be out of date by setting on shelf.
Title: Re: Hans device expiration
Post by: Joe Timney on January 15, 2012, 04:13:41 PM
ECTA does not require re-inspection of a Hans Devise. We will evaluate all safety equipment for damage at the tech.

Title: Re: Hans device expiration
Post by: Jack Gifford on January 16, 2012, 12:58:44 AM
...
ECTA does not require re-inspection of a Hans Devise...[
Joe- any other SFI-spec pieces that ECTA does not require re-certification of? For instance, clutch cans?
Title: Re: Hans device expiration
Post by: Joe Timney on January 16, 2012, 08:36:18 AM
We do not require recerts on firesuits, clutch cans and flywheel shields.
